Our curriculum covers everything you need to know to become a confident and skilled groomer.
• Foundational Skills:
○ Tool recognition, use, and maintenance
○ Scissoring exercises and proper handling techniques
○ Brushing, bathing, and drying for different coat types
○ Safe nail trimming and ear cleaning
• Grooming & Styling Techniques:
○ Understanding dog anatomy, proportion, and symmetry
○ Mastering basic cuts with clippers (Blades #7, #5, #4)
○ Finishing techniques for heads and general styling
○ Advanced scissor work and use of guard combs
• Breed-Specific Knowledge:
○ In-depth study of dog breeds, coat types, and group classifications
○ Hands-on practice with popular breeds like Shih Tzus, Poodles, Schnauzers, Golden Retrievers, and more.
• Safety and Professionalism:
○ First aid for common grooming incidents
○ Understanding dog behavior and safe handling
○ Health and safety for the groomer
○ Business essentials, including client contracts

The total cost is $7,500. This fee is all-inclusive.
The cost covers your 40 hours of theoretical tuition, 150 hours of hands-on practice, and all the necessary tools and materials you need to begin your new career.
